Guseh: On FA Cup games this weekend.
The FA cup brings a different competition into the schedule this weekend. From a betting point of view, these games can be summed up in 1 word... MOTIVATION !
Are teams motivated to win? Will they play their strongest lineup ? Do they care (Chelsea, Man U, Liverpool, Man City, Arsenal, Tottenham, Everton) ? These teams tend to use the Cup to give the second team a run out. Players on the fringe of the 1st team, or guys that need game time. What you get is a disjointed lineup. Players are not match-fit, they have not played with each other enough, and there is no trust or real cutting edge. These 'BIG' teams turn in lethargic performances with no flow. It makes a tricky betting situation... A huge question ... What's the starting lineup and how will they play ? Lower league teams love the FA Cup. It's their biggest shot, and they are super MOTIVATED. The strongest squads are usually picked. Players 'UP' their game in an attempt to impress potential employers. This is their Champions League. It is also a more accurate platform for predicting outcomes of games, because there are fewer unknowns. If you are betting on FA Cup games, look at intensity, line up and motivation, and bet on teams that will play their strongest line-ups!
Good luck.... Bros... you got things slightly mixed up. Top teams like Chelsea, Man U, Arsenal and co are super motivated to win the FA cup as it is the most prestigious cup tournament in England. It is usually the small to mid-table teams that are usually victims of clubs in the lower league. You correctly pointed out that teams in the lower division are usually highly motivated. There are frequent giant killing games in the FA cup, so guys bet with caution especially when teams close to the relegation zone in the EPL are playing lower division clubs. |

Truetalk about striking becoming the most important discipline in MMA. Some years ago Wrestling and Grappling was very important because most strikers had no answer or were like fish out of water in the clinch position and on the ground. Currently, a lot of fighters have improved their clinch, submission and takedown defence skills thereby severely limiting the Grappling advantage. On the other hand striking game dominated by traditional martial arts such as TKD and mainstream martial arts like boxing, kick boxing and Muay Thai requires years of experience, practice and sparring. Therefore guys such as Connor, Cody No Love, Steven Wonder boy and Jose Aldo with excellent striking game are set to dominate MMA (UFC). |
